"Prince's Dictionary of Legal Abbreviations contains an extensive range of acronyms, abbreviations, and symbols found in primary and secondary sources of American legal literature. Providing this information in both forward and reverse order, this book assists users in identifying the meaning of abbreviations and acronyms (Part I) and in identifying abbreviations for titles, names, and terms (Part II). Titles, names, and terms often have multiple abbreviations or acronyms. This book, without distinction, includes abbreviations established by well-recognized authorities such as The Bluebook: A Uniform System of Citation as well as abbreviations otherwise devised by authors in their efforts to shorten legal references and citations.
